Jesper de Jong wrote:

>     /home/jesper/gcc-4.1.2/configure --enable-threads=win32

Where do people keep getting this idea that Cygwin uses win32 threads?
It doesn't, and you've most likely built a compiler that is subtly
broken in some way.  Cygwin uses pthreads, this should be
--enable-threads=posix.
